Lane Closures Announced On I-91 In Wallingford

The Connecticut Department of Transportation is advising motorists of lane closures that will be in effect on I-91 in Wallingford.

WALLINGFORD, CT — The Connecticut Department of Transportation has announced lane closures that will be in effect on I-91 north and southbound from Exit 15 to the Wallingford / Meriden town line for a project that starts next week.

Officials said that geotechnical subsurface investigations, otherwise known as soil borings, will be performed related to the replacement of the Carpenter Lane bridge over I-91 in Wallingford.

“These soil borings are performed to determine the type of soil, and the depth and location of the rock under the ground surface,” officials wrote in an advisory. “This information is used by the project team to design the bridge foundations to be constructed by a contractor.”

The activity is scheduled to begin on Monday, June 22 and be completed by Thursday, July 2, according to officials.

LANE CLOSURE/DETOUR INFO

There will be various lane closures on I-91 north and southbound from Exit 15 to the Wallingford / Meriden town line beginning on Monday, June 22, between the hours of 9 a.m. to 3 p.m. that are scheduled to be completed on Thursday, July 2, 2026. Traffic control signing patterns will guide motorists through the work zone.

Motorists should be aware that modifications or extensions to this schedule may become necessary due to weather delays or other unforeseen conditions. Motorists are advised to maintain a safe speed when driving in this area.
